Her full name is María Rosario Pilar Martínez Molina Moquiere de les Esperades Santa Ana Romanguera y de la Najosa Rasten, but she's better known to the world as Charo. According to Wikipedia, "One of Charo's regrets is that because of her flamboyant stage presence, she has been overlooked as a serious guitar player." Even with those fingernails, which have got to be an impediment to the flamenco style

All flamencos and flamencas play with nails. Nails are an essential component of the brightness of the tone.
